How does osmosis affect plant cells? … WebThe uptake of water in plant root hair cells relies on osmosis. The cytoplasm and vacuole of plant root hair cells contain many dissolved solutes, meaning it has a lower water potential than the soil. Due to this water potential gradient, water molecules move into the plant root hair cell from the soil. This water potential gradient is ...

WebRoot hairs of the plant take in water from the soil by osmosis. The cell membrane of the root hair cell acts a partially permeable membrane (the cell wall is fully permeable) and because the cell sap inside the vacuole is a strong solution (low water concentration) water passes from the soil (high water concentration) into the root hair cell by ...
